    "First Step into the Bhagavad Gita" is the pioneering volume in the Gita Odyssey series, co-authored by Rajesh Rabindranath, Avanti Kundalia, and Vikrant Singh Tomar. The cacophony of daily life often reduces texts of timeless wisdom to ornate shelf decorations. "First Step into the Bhagavad Gita" begins to weave ancient wisdom into the fiery tapestry of modern life, opening a pathway to material prosperity, inner peace, and practical spirituality. Whether you are a professional, a householder, a student, or an ardent seeker of truth, this book equips you with pragmatic spiritual knowledge from within the Bhagavad Gita to help you follow your unique path with fortitude and grace. May the "First Step into Bhagavad Gita" initiate your epic journey toward a step-by-step understanding of yourself, the world, the power that holds it all together, and what lies beyond.

    • Rajesh Rabindranath is a multifaceted technology and management professional who harmonizes his engagement with modern innovations, particularly artificial intelligence, with a passion for Vedantic teachings. Based in New Jersey, USA, he passionately imparts the timeless wisdom of the Bhagavad Gita through regular classes and at diverse forums, including corporate events and interfaith gatherings. Rajesh's personal life reflects the harmonious blend of worldly responsibilities and spiritual pursuits, as he finds joy in moments spent with his wife, Deepthy, and daughter, Daksha. Avanti Kundalia is a Vedanta teacher and life coach based in Singapore. Through ongoing intensive research and rigorous experimentation, she has dedicated her life to validating the efficacy of Vedantic teachings in daily life. A mother of two, Avanti finds her greatest fulfillment in teaching the Bhagavad Gita to all age groups in relatable ways that guarantee dramatic inner transformations. Her insightful writings on Vedanta and beautiful translations of spiritual texts in English are well-loved by seekers of truth. A true patriot of Bharat, Avanti has been championing the cause of Sanatan Dharma traditions across the globe, especially with householders. Dr. Vikrant Singh Tomar is a globally acknowledged scholar, writer, and management consultant. He is nominated by Civil 20 (under G-20) as the ‘International Coordinator,’ for the “Vasudhaiva Kutumbakam”, to promote in G-20 Nations. He addressed the United Nations Headquarters in Geneva on the International Day of Conscience. He is the global convener of the World Yoga Summit in Germany in 2023. He is the Director of Project Inc. USA, Convenor of ‘United Consciousness Global’, and Board Member of the European Yoga Federation and Spiritual Council in Africa.
